【怎么在linux下安装mysql数据库并配置的方法】.docx
2.虚拟产品一经售出概不退款(资源遇到问题,请及时私信上传者)
在Linux环境下安装MySQL数据库并进行配置是每个系统管理员或开发者必备的技能之一。MySQL是一个流行的开源关系型数据库管理系统,广泛应用于各种规模的企业和项目。以下将详细介绍如何在Linux上安装MySQL 5.6版本,并配置相关环境。 你需要获取MySQL的RPM包。RPM(Red Hat Package Manager)是Linux发行版中的软件包管理器,用于安装、升级和管理软件。对于MySQL 5.6,你需要下载以下三个RPM包: 1. MySQL-server-5.6.21-1.linux_glibc2.5.x86_64.rpm:这是MySQL服务器的安装包,包含了数据库引擎和服务端组件。 2. MySQL-client-5.6.21-1.linux_glibc2.5.x86_64.rpm:这是MySQL客户端的安装包,提供了与MySQL服务器交互的工具,如`mysql`命令行客户端。 3. MySQL-devel-5.6.21-1.linux_glibc2.5.x86_64.rpm:这是MySQL开发依赖包,包含头文件和库,用于编译连接MySQL的程序。 由于不能直接提供链接,你需要访问MySQL的官方网站下载这些包。下载完成后,通过`scp`或FTP等工具将它们上传到你的Linux服务器。 安装步骤如下: 1. 使用`rpm`命令安装MySQL服务器: ``` sudo rpm -ivh MySQL-server-5.6.21-1.linux_glibc2.5.x86_64.rpm ``` 在安装过程中,系统会为root用户生成一个随机密码,并将其保存在`/root/.mysql_secret`文件中。 2. 接着安装MySQL客户端: ``` sudo rpm -ivh MySQL-client-5.6.21-1.linux_glibc2.5.x86_64.rpm ``` 3. 再安装MySQL开发依赖包: ``` sudo rpm -ivh MySQL-devel-5.6.21-1.linux_glibc2.5.x86_64.rpm ``` 4. 安装完成后,你需要启动MySQL服务。可以使用以下两种命令之一: ``` sudo service mysql start 或 sudo /etc/init.d/mysql start ``` 5. 如果在尝试连接MySQL时遇到`ERROR 2002 (HY000): Can't connect to local MySQL server through socket '/var/lib/mysql/mysql.sock' (2)`的错误,可能是因为MySQL服务尚未启动。确保使用上述命令启动了服务。 6. 初始安装后,MySQL的root用户通常没有设置密码。你可以通过以下方式设置密码: ``` sudo mysql_secure_installation ``` 按照提示,输入新密码并确认。 7. 设置完密码后,需要重启MySQL服务以应用更改: ``` sudo systemctl restart mysql ``` 8. 现在你可以使用`mysql`命令行客户端登录MySQL服务器: ``` mysql -u root -p ``` 输入你刚才设置的密码,然后按回车。 9. 验证MySQL是否正常运行,可以使用`netstat`命令检查3306端口是否监听: ``` netstat -tulnp | grep 3306 ``` 如果看到类似`LISTEN`的状态,说明MySQL服务正在运行。 以上就是在Linux环境下安装和配置MySQL 5.6的基本步骤。确保在安装过程中遵循最佳安全实践,例如定期备份数据、限制远程访问、使用强密码等。此外,还可以通过配置文件`my.cnf`调整MySQL的性能参数,以适应你的特定需求。
- 粉丝: 1
- 资源: 8万+
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助